Required Courses for a B.S. in Nutrition

Bachelor of Science in Nutrition  
Foundations (25-26 hours)
FAES 100 or HEC 100 or UVC 100 1
English 110C01 5
2nd Writing Course (367) from list (may be used for other GEC requirement) 5
Oral Communication - Agr Com 390 or Comm 321 4-5
Math 150 (Most medical schools require Math 151 as well) 5
Natural Science (20 hours)
Biology 113, 114 or H115, H116 10
Physics 111, 112  or 131, 132 (Most med schools also require Physics 113 or 133) 10
International Issues - Fulfill with selected Social Science or Arts & Humanities  
Non-Western or Global course (* on curriculum sheet) -
Non-Western* or Western, non-US course ( on curriculum sheet) -
Social Science (15 hours)
Agr Econ 200 or Econ 200 5
Rural Soc 105 or Soc 101 5
One course from social science list - certain courses fulfill International Issues 5
Arts and Humanities  (20 hours)
One course in History from approved list - certain courses fulfill International Issues 5
One Literature course from approved list - certain courses fulfill International Issues 5
One Visual & Performing Arts from list - certain courses fulfill International Issues 5
One additional Arts&Humanities or History from list-certain fulfill International Issues 5
Other Requirements (8 -10 hours)  
Contemporary Issues (597) - selected from approved list 5
Internship - Humn Nutr/FST 589 or An Sci 489 3-5
Choose two of the following to fulfill 3rd writing requirement:  
    Hum Nutr 610, An Sci 630.01, 630.02, Human Nutr/An Sci/Food Sci 761, 762  
Supporting Requirements (48-59 hours)  
Chemistry 121, 122, 123 or H201, H202, H203 15
Chemistry 251, 252 6
Chemistry 211 or 221 (recommended) or Biochemistry 521 or Mol Gen 601 or 602 0-5
Chemistry 245 or 254 (Most medical schools require Chem 221, 253, 254, and 255) 2-3
Biochemistry 511 5
Molecular Genetics 500 (recommended for pre-medicine) or Animal Sciences 320 5
Microbiology 509 (recommended) or 520 & 521 5-10
EEOB 232 (recommended) or An Sci 310 (Most medical schoools also require EEOB 410 and 512) 5
Data analysis (Chem 221 recommended) 5
Major (25-28 hours)
Human Nutrition 310 or Anim Sci 330 5
HumNutr 610 or An Sci 630.01 or 630.02* (630.01/.02 can also fulfill 3rd writing requirement) 5
Select one of 3 options in Advanced nutrition: 10
    (1) Food Science 761 and 762 or 763 (761/762 can also fulfill 3rd writing requirement) -
    (2) Human Nutrition 612.02, 612.01 and Med Diet 546 -
    (3) Med Diet 520, 521 and 546 -
Select from Human Nutrition 295, 313, 314, 415, 450, 504, 506, 593, 704, 705; Human Nutrition/Animal Sciences/Food Science 761, 762, 763 5-6
   
Minimum for the Degree 191
   
Reccommendations for students pursuing medical careers:  
Take Chem 221, 253, 254, 255, Physics 113, Math 151, Mol Gen 500, and EEOB 410, 512  
Reccommendations for students pursuing graduate studies in nutrition:  
Take one of the following: Chem 211, 222; Biochem 521; Mol Gen 601, 602
